
Dr. Laurel Brundage
Intro
I am a licensed clinical psychologist with over 25 years of experience, including six years working exclusively with nursing home residents. I have helped older adults cope with loss, loneliness, serious health problems, anxiety, depression, relationship concerns, and stress. I feel honored when people allow me to support their growth as they face challenges and make difficult changes.
How would you describe your approach to care?
The therapeutic relationship is the most important factor for success in psychotherapy, so I focus on establishing and maintaining a relationship grounded in trust and unconditional acceptance. I utilize therapeutic techniques from cognitive behavioral therapy and acceptance and commitment therapy to facilitate change, and I tailor treatment plans to each person’s individual needs.
What should be expected in the first session?
My primary goal for the first session is to begin establishing trust and fostering hope. We will talk about the main issues that brought you to therapy and your expectations. We will also discuss how therapy works, what to expect moving forward, and begin identifying goals that feel meaningful to you.
